Myrlande Constant(b. 1968, Port-au-Prince, Haiti; lives in Port-au-Prince, Haiti) is known for her striking beaded and sequin embellished textile artworks. In March 2023, the solo exhibition ‘Myrlande Constant: The Work of Radiance’ will open at the Fowler Museum in Los Angeles, CA. In 2022, her work was featured in ‘The Milk of Dreams,’ La Biennale di Venezia, 59th International Art Exhibition in Venice, Italy. In 2019, a solo exhibition of Constant’s work, ‘The Last Supper,’ was exhibited at the Faena Hotel in Miami Beach, FL.

Constant’s work is included in the following museum collections: Alfond Collection of Contemporary Art, Rollins Museum of Art, Winter Park, FL; American Folk Art Museum, New York, NY; Art Institute of Chicago, Chicago, IL; Fowler Museum, UCLA, Los Angeles, CA; Lowe Art Museum, University of Miami, Miami, FL; Pérez Art Museum, Miami, FL; Tampa Museum of Art, Tampa, FL; RISD Museum, Providence, RI, and Waterloo Center for the Arts, Waterloo, IA.
